The Registration-Based System for Active Pharmaceutical Ingredients (APIs)
The active pharmaceutical ingredients (APIs) are the core components of pharmaceutical products that directly affect human health. With the increasing complexity and variability of APIs, the traditional regulatory approach has become increasingly inadequate. To ensure the safety, efficacy, and quality of APIs, the Chinese government has introduced the Registration-Based System for Active Pharmaceutical Ingredients (APIs) to replace the traditional "notice of approval" system. This system aims to improve the efficiency and scientific basis of API registration and supervision, providing a more standardized and transparent regulatory framework for the entire API development process.
Background of the Registration-Based System
The Registration-Based System for APIs is part of the broader regulatory reforms implemented by the Chinese government to enhance the global drug safety and quality standards. The traditional "notice of approval" system has been criticized for its inefficiency, lack of scientific rigor, and high regulatory burden on manufacturers. The new system is designed to streamline the registration process, reduce administrative costs, and improve the quality of API registration by integrating scientific evaluation and regulatory oversight.
The system is based on the principles of scientific evaluation, risk assessment, and continuous improvement. It requires manufacturers to submit detailed technical and safety information about their APIs before registration. The regulatory authorities then evaluate this information based on established scientific criteria and regulatory standards. The system also emphasizes the importance of post-approval surveillance and quality control to ensure the continued safety and efficacy of APIs in the market.
Implementation Steps
The implementation of the Registration-Based System for APIs involves several key steps:
1. Declaration and Submission: Manufacturers are required to declare their APIs and submit detailed technical specifications, including chemical structure, physical and chemical properties, bioavailability, and safety data. This information must be submitted in accordance with the regulatory guidelines.
2. Scientific Evaluation: The regulatory authorities evaluate the submitted information based on internationally recognized scientific standards and regulatory requirements. This evaluation includes toxicological studies, pharmacokinetic studies, and other scientific assessments to determine the safety and efficacy of the API.
3. Registration and Approval: Based on the evaluation results, the regulatory authorities may approve or require revisions to the submitted information. If approval is granted, the manufacturer obtains a registration certificate for the API.
4. Post-Approval Surveillance: Once an API is registered, it must undergo continuous surveillance to ensure its continued safety and efficacy. This includes periodic quality checks, stability studies, and post-marketing surveillance activities.
5. Continuous Improvement: The system encourages manufacturers to continuously improve the quality and safety of their APIs based on feedback from regulatory authorities and advances in scientific research.
Key Regulatory Focus Areas
The Registration-Based System for APIs places a strong emphasis on several key regulatory focus areas:
1. Scientific Rigor: The system requires manufacturers to provide scientifically rigorous technical and safety information. This includes detailed toxicological and pharmacokinetic studies, as well as other scientific evaluations to demonstrate the safety and efficacy of the API.
2. Risk Assessment: Regulatory authorities are required to conduct comprehensive risk assessments to identify potential hazards associated with the API. This includes evaluating the potential impact of the API on human health and the environment.
3. Quality Control: The system emphasizes the importance of quality control measures to ensure the consistency and stability of the API. This includes quality control tests, stability studies, and other activities to monitor the performance of the API over time.
4. Public Health Protection: The system is designed to protect public health by ensuring that APIs meet established safety and efficacy standards. This includes requiring manufacturers to provide adequate information to the regulatory authorities to enable safe and effective use of the API in the market.
5. harmonization with international standards: The system is designed to harmonize with international standards for API registration and surveillance, ensuring that Chinese APIs meet the same high standards as those from other countries.
